North Dakota HB 1255 (65) — AN ACT to create and enact a new chapter to title 24 and a new subsection to section 391205.3 of the North Dakota Century Code, relating to the creation of a large truck primary highway network and the permitting of increased vehicle weights.

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2017-01-09 Introduced, first reading, referred Transportation Committee introduction
  • 2017-01-27 Committee Hearing 10:00
  • 2017-02-06 Reported back amended, do pass, amendment placed on calendar 10 0 4 committee-passage-favorable, committee-passage
  • 2017-02-07 Amendment adopted
  • 2017-02-07 Rereferred to Appropriations
  • 2017-02-14 Reported back, do pass, place on calendar 20 0 1 committee-passage-favorable, committee-passage
  • 2017-02-21 Second reading, passed, yeas 92 nays 0 reading-2, passage
  • 2017-02-22 Received from House
  • 2017-02-22 Introduced, first reading, referred Transportation Committee introduction
  • 2017-03-16 Committee Hearing 02:15
  • 2017-03-17 Reported back, do pass 6 0 0 committee-passage-favorable, committee-passage
  • 2017-03-17 Rereferred to Appropriations
  • 2017-03-24 Committee Hearing 08:30
  • 2017-03-24 Reported back, do pass, place on calendar 14 0 0 committee-passage-favorable, committee-passage
  • 2017-03-27 Rereferred to Transportation
  • 2017-03-28 Reported back amended, do pass, amendment placed on calendar 6 0 0 committee-passage-favorable, committee-passage
  • 2017-03-29 Amendment adopted, placed on calendar
  • 2017-03-29 Second reading, passed as amended, yeas 47 nays 0 reading-2, passage
  • 2017-03-30 Returned to House (12)
  • 2017-04-04 Concurred
  • 2017-04-04 Second reading, passed, yeas 92 nays 0 reading-2, passage
  • 2017-04-05 Signed by President
  • 2017-04-06 Signed by Speaker
  • 2017-04-07 Sent to Governor executive-receipt
  • 2017-04-12 Signed by Governor 04/10 executive-signature
  • 2017-04-13 Filed with Secretary Of State 04/10 introduction
